The Relationship Between Blood Vessels and Mental Ability

The blood arteries that supply the brain with nutrition and oxygen are the fundamental components of the brain-heart connection. The brain uses about 20% of the oxygen in the body, despite making up only 2% of the total weight of the body. An effective and healthy blood supply is necessary for the brain to carry out its tasks, which include information processing, memory retention, and emotional control. By ensuring that blood reaches every area of the brain, the cardiovascular system supports brain function and aids in waste product removal.

When blood vessel health is compromised, problems occur. Blood flow to the brain can be reduced by diseases like high blood pressure, atherosclerosis (narrowing of the arteries), and other cardiovascular disorders. This can result in a variety of cognitive problems, from mild memory loss to more severe forms of cognitive impairment like vascular dementia or Alzheimer's disease.

Recognizing the Impact of Blood Vessel Health on the Brain

1. Alzheimer's disease and atherosclerosis

Plaque accumulation in the arteries is known as atherosclerosis, and it can impede blood flow to the brain. This restricted blood flow has the potential to harm brain tissue over time and play a role in the development of tiny, quiet strokes that impede cognitive function. These strokes can compound and lead to more severe cognitive deficits, especially in memory and executive function, even if there are no obvious symptoms at first.

2. Hypertension and the Condition of the Brain

One of the most prevalent risk factors for both heart disease and cognitive decline is hypertension, or high blood pressure. Elevated blood pressure has the potential to harm the fragile blood vessels in the brain, resulting in little bleeding and decreased blood flow. A series of issues, including inflammation and the demise of neurons, the brain's communication cells, are brought on by this injury. Untreated high blood pressure raises the risk of stroke and vascular dementia over time, both of which are harmful to cognitive function.

3. The Function of Fat

Blood cholesterol levels are crucial for maintaining cardiovascular health and, consequently, brain health. Elevated low-density lipoprotein (LDL) cholesterol, commonly known as "bad cholesterol," can impede blood flow to the brain by causing plaque to build in the arteries. On the other hand, high-density lipoprotein (HDL), also referred to as "good cholesterol," assists in removing excess LDL from the arteries, lowering the chance of blockages and promoting normal blood flow to the brain.

4. Brain Illness and Cognitive Deficit

When blood supply to the brain is cut off or decreased, brain tissue is deprived of oxygen and nutrients, which leads to a stroke. Although even minor, undiscovered strokes, sometimes referred to as "silent strokes," can build over time and dramatically impair cognitive ability, massive strokes can cause acute and frequently irreparable cognitive loss. Reducing the risk of ischemic strokes, which are caused by clogged blood vessels, and hemorrhagic strokes, which are caused by ruptured blood vessels, requires maintaining heart and blood vessel health.

Encouraging Heart Health to Preserve Cognitive Health

It is crucial to develop lifestyle practices that promote heart health and, consequently, brain health given the evident link between cardiovascular health and cognitive performance. The following are some crucial tactics to preserve wholesome blood vessels and safeguard mental health:

1. Control your blood pressure

It is imperative to maintain blood pressure within a healthy range, which is generally less than 120/80 mmHg, in order to safeguard the heart and brain. One of the main risk factors for vascular dementia and stroke is uncontrolled hypertension. Reduce sodium intake, exercise frequently, maintain a heart-healthy diet, and control stress in order to lower blood pressure.

2. Make the Diet Heart-Healthy

Heart health can be supported by eating a diet high in fruits, vegetables, whole grains, lean meats, and healthy fats. It has been demonstrated that the Mediterranean diet, which places an emphasis on heart-healthy fats like olive oil, almonds, and seafood, lowers the risk of heart disease and cognitive decline. Furthermore, foods high in antioxidants, such as leafy greens and berries, can shield blood vessels from inflammation and oxidative stress.

3. Engage in Regular Exercise

Engaging in physical activity is crucial for preserving the health of blood vessels and lowering the risk of heart disease. Frequent cardiovascular exercise, such swimming, cycling, or walking, strengthens the heart, decreases blood pressure, and improves circulation. Additionally, exercise directly helps the brain by promoting mood improvement, increased cognitive function, and neuroplasticity—the brain's capacity for adaptation and reorganization.

4. Manage Your Cholesterol Amount

It is vital to uphold optimal cholesterol levels to avert the accumulation of plaque within the arterial walls. A balanced diet low in trans and saturated fats, regular exercise, and, when needed, statin drugs can help control cholesterol and lower the risk of cognitive impairment brought on by atherosclerosis.

5. Give Up Smoking and Reduce Alcohol Use

One of the main risk factors for heart disease and cognitive impairment is smoking. Cigarette smoke contains substances that cause blood vessel damage and lower the brain's oxygen supply. Giving up smoking can dramatically reduce the chances of dementia and stroke, as well as improve cardiovascular health. It's crucial to drink alcohol in moderation, if at all, as excessive intake can harm the heart and brain.

6. Get Restful Sleep

The health of the heart and brain depend on sleep. High blood pressure, heart disease, and cognitive loss are all associated with poor sleep, particularly in the case of diseases like sleep apnea that interfere with breathing while you sleep. Try to get between seven and nine hours of good sleep every night to promote cardiovascular and mental well-being.

7. Handle Stress 

Chronic stress increases blood pressure, causes inflammation, and encourages unhealthy habits like smoking and overeating, all of which have a negative impact on heart and brain health. Discovering useful stress-reduction methods, like yoga, meditation, or deep breathing exercises, might lessen the damaging effects of stress on your heart and brain.
